Format
The tournament consists of 3 games of Blood Bowl using the BB2020 / Second Season ruleset.

Coaches will play 3 games against 3 different opponents. The first round will be paired randomly, and Swiss pairings will be used for rounds 2 and 3. This will be a resurrection format: your roster resets after each match (no SPP, injuries, raised dead etc.).

The official Blood Bowl rules, and all current FAQs and errata published up to the date of the tournament will be in effect.
In the event of any rules disagreements, TO’s decision is final.

Team Tiers

The tournament uses a 5-tier system:

TIER 1 - Amazons, Dark Elves, Lizardmen, Shambling Undead & Wood Elves
-> 1.11M gold pieces / 6 primary skills / 0-1 Star Players

TIER 2 – Dwarfs, Necromantic Horror, Norse, Orcs, Skaven, Slann, Tomb Kings, Underworld Denizens & Vampires
-> 1.12M gold pieces / 6 primary skills & 1 secondary skill / 0-1 Star Players

TIER 3 – Chaos Dwarfs, Elven Union, High Elves, Humans, Imperial Nobility, Khorne & Old World Alliance
-> 1.13M gold pieces / 7 primary skills & 1 secondary skill / 0-1 Star Players

TIER 4 – Black Orcs, Chaos Chosen, Chaos Renegades, Gnomes, Nurgle & Snotlings
-> 1.14M gold pieces / 8 primary skills & 1 secondary skill / 0-2 Star Players

TIER 5 – Goblins, Halflings & Ogres
-> 1.15M gold pieces / 8 primary skills & 2 secondary skills / 0-2 Star Players

Skills
After building a team coaches may add additional skills to the players on their team (Star Players may not receive additional skills), according to their tier, as outlined below. All additional skills will need to be correctly identified (Eg loom bands, skill ings etc.). Secondary skill allowances can be swapped for a primary skill and up to 2 primary skills can be stacked on a player.

Tournament Special Rule
The Fates of Firestorm are fickle indeed and what is not to love about poorly aimed fireballs?!?!? Each team will have access to the wizard Horatio X. Schottenheim. Once per game, Horatio may cast the following spell:

"TAKE THIS! OOOPS..."

Horatio conjures up a fireball spell and flings it with his legendarily poor aim in the general direction of the action on the pitch. Horatio may cast this spell at the end of either player's team turn, before the next team turn begins. Choose a target square anywhere on the pitch. The target square is moved D3 squares in a direction determined by rolling a D8 and referring to the Random Direction template. After moving the target square, roll a D6 for each Standing player (from either team) that is either in the target square or a square adjacent to it:

On a roll of 4+, the player has been hit by the Fireball.
On a roll of 1-3, the player manages to avoid the Fireball.
Any Standing players hit by the Fireball are Knocked Down. When a player is Knocked Down by a Fireball, you may apply a +1 modifier to either the Armour roll or Injury roll. This modifier may be applied after the roll has been made.
